Del Mar Race No. 3 (7:03 p.m. ET/4:03 p.m. PT)
#7 Night Party (4-1)

Debuting daughter of Capital Account has displayed enough early speed in her morning preps to outrun a maiden claiming juvenile field, and while her stamina might be a tad suspect she should be able to get loose early and roll all the way to the wire. It’s been a slow year for this barn, but veteran trainer Hector Palma has a history of success with young stock and looks to have this filly plenty fit and properly spotted. She’s listed at 4-1 on the morning line and represents a reasonable gamble at the price in the Win pool and in the various rolling exotics.

Del Mar Race No. 5 (8:03 p.m. ET/5:03 p.m. PT)
#9 Laurel Canyon (7-2)

Launches a comeback in this first-level allowance optional claimer for fillies and mares and because she won her debut back in the spring of 2021 we know she can fire fresh. From a barn that has superior stats with layoff runners, the daughter of Nyquist attracts leading jockey Juan Hernandez while adding Lasix for the first time following a string of strong drills at San Luis Rey Downs that should have her cranked and ready.  At 7-2 on the morning, this stakes-placed sophomore filly seems reasonably priced in a race that doesn’t appear all that deep for the level.
